Status: Resident.
Distribution and Abundance: Common.
Primary Habitat: General
occurrence.
Flight Period: Single
brooded from June to August.
Observations: The
moth was particularly common at an m.v. light trap
running in a Wellingborough garden in the 1950s
with the best year being 1951 when 531 moths were taken
between 10 June and 24 August. As a comparison the year
2000 was the most productive recent year at the Pitsford
Water light traps when 319 moths were recorded between 12
June and 19 August.
L.O.N.: 1907.
Several localities. Fairly common.
First Record: 1882,
Hull & Tomalin.
